## Usage
|
||
|
||
To install a WebdriverIO project, you may choose one of the following methods:
|
||
|
||
#### npx
|
||
|
||
```sh
|
||
npx create-wdio@latest ./e2e
|
||
```
|
||
|
||
_[`npx`](https://medium.com/@maybekatz/introducing-npx-an-npm-package-runner-55f7d4bd282b) is a package runner tool that comes with npm 5.2+ and higher, see [instructions for older npm versions](https://gist.github.com/gaearon/4064d3c23a77c74a3614c498a8bb1c5f)_
|
||
|
||
#### npm
|
||
|
||
```sh
|
||
npm init wdio@latest ./e2e
|
||
```
|
||
|
||
_[`npm init <initializer>`](https://docs.npmjs.com/cli/v10/commands/npm-init) is available in npm 6+_
|
||
|
||
#### yarn
|
||
|
||
```sh
|
||
yarn create wdio@latest ./e2e
|
||
```
|
||
|
||
_[`yarn create <starter-kit-package>`](https://yarnpkg.com/lang/en/docs/cli/create/) is available in Yarn 0.25+_
|
||
|
||
#### pnpm
|
||
|
||
```sh
|
||
pnpm create wdio ./e2e
|
||
```
|
||
|
||
_[`pnpm create <starter-kit-package>`](https://pnpm.io/cli/create) is available in pnpm v7+_
|
||
|
||
It will create a directory called `e2e` inside the current folder.
|
||
Then it will run the configuration wizard that will help you set-up your framework.
|
||
|
||
|
||
## Supported Options
|
||
|
||
You can pass the following command line flags to modify the bootstrap mechanism:
|
||
|
||
* `--dev` - Install all packages as `devDependencies` (default: `true`)
|
||
* `--yes` - Will fill in all config defaults without prompting (default: `false`)
|
||
* `--npm-tag` - use a specific NPM tag for `@wdio/cli` package (default: `latest`)
